Output 59d7e7d05e722c28b92c6475de22d6fe452b24b5804ceb6870a5ebc98e48a827:0

value
125126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ba0633f32a17d14a6f181cf44f7ec5df744659d OP_EQUAL
address
34D6JevsRXrwsTtC5LhH3hKgVMasTpqgKY
transaction
59d7e7d05e722c28b92c6475de22d6fe452b24b5804ceb6870a5ebc98e48a827
spent
true